Explore Kings Park and Botanic Yard



One of the most effective ways to experience the all-natural beauty of Perth is by discovering Kings Park and Botanic Garden. Extending over 400 hectares, this extensive environment-friendly space offers an one-of-a-kind combination of native plants, strolling trails, and magnificent city views. The park is home to among the biggest and most attractive inner-city parks in the world, making it an excellent location for both leisure and adventure.


Site visitors can walk along the considerable network of courses that meander through the park, enabling immersive experiences with over 3,000 varieties of Western Australian plants. The Botanic Yard features themed gardens showcasing the region's diverse communities, giving an instructional experience about regional biodiversity.


For those seeking a much more energetic experience, Kings Park offers opportunities for biking and jogging along its picturesque trails. The park additionally hosts various occasions throughout the year, including outside shows and seasonal festivals, which boost its dynamic ambience. Furthermore, the War Memorial and the iconic DNA Tower give historic context and scenic sights, making Kings Park and Botanic Yard a must-visit destination for anybody aiming to appreciate the cultural and natural heritage of Perth.


Browse Through Cottesloe Coastline



Cottesloe Beach is an ultimate location for those wanting to experience Perth's magnificent coast. Renowned for its gold sands and azure waters, this coastline provides a best setting for sunbathing, searching, and swimming. The gentle waves make it excellent for families and newbie web surfers alike, while the attractive backdrop of hand trees and dynamic sunsets adds to its beauty.

Visitors can enjoy a leisurely walk along the breathtaking beachfront, where a range of coffee shops and restaurants serve tasty local food. The well-known Cottesloe Pavilion, situated exactly on the beach, offers an unique dining experience with spectacular sea sights. For those aiming to take part in recreational tasks, the coastline includes volley ball courts and enough space for picnics.


Cottesloe Beach is additionally a cultural center, organizing different events throughout the year, including the vibrant Sculpture by the Sea exhibition, which showcases spectacular artworks along the coastline. Whether you are seeking relaxation or journey, Cottesloe Coastline assures a memorable experience, making it an important stop on your Perth schedule. With its exciting appeal and welcoming ambience, it captures the significance of the Australian beach way of life.

Experience Fremantle Markets





Located in the historic heart of Fremantle, the Fremantle Markets supply a dynamic and diverse buying experience that catches the essence of neighborhood society. Developed in 1897, these markets are housed in a wonderfully recovered Victorian-era structure, showcasing a varied variety of artisanal products, fresh produce, and distinct crafts.


Visitors can stroll through the busy aisles, engaging with regional artisans and suppliers that take satisfaction in their hand-crafted items. From elegant jewelry and style products to health food stalls and exquisite deals with, the marketplaces provide to numerous tastes and preferences. The lively atmosphere is boosted by street entertainers and musicians, creating an inviting setup for family members and travelers alike.


Along with shopping, the Fremantle Markets emphasize sustainability, with several suppliers sourcing their items in your area and utilizing environment-friendly methods. This dedication to environmental consciousness adds a purposeful measurement to the buying experience.


Whether you are looking for a memorable gift, enjoying delicious click for source cooking delights, or just absorbing the vibrant setting, the Fremantle Markets are an unmissable emphasize in any see to Perth. Experience the neighborhood appeal and creative thinking that make these markets a precious destination for both citizens and site visitors.


Take a Swan River Cruise Ship



Set against the sensational backdrop of Perth's sky line, taking a Swan River cruise ship offers a memorable method to explore the city's all-natural elegance and rich history. The river twists with picturesque landscapes, supplying breathtaking sights of rich parks, elegant homes, and lively wild animals. Cruise ships usually range from leisurely hour-long tours to much longer, extra immersive experiences that consist of eating choices.


As you slide along the water, educated overviews share interesting stories about Perth's development, its Aboriginal heritage, and the relevance of the Swan River itself. The cruise ship also gives an one-of-a-kind perspective to see famous landmarks such as the Elizabeth Quay and the historical Fremantle, enhancing your understanding of the location's culture.


For those looking for a charming night, sunset cruise ships use a captivating environment, where the city lights begin to sparkle versus the darkening sky. Conversely, family-friendly alternatives commonly feature amusement, creating a delightful trip with liked ones. Whether you are a local or a visitor, a Swan River cruise ship is an essential component of experiencing Perth, integrating relaxation with a recognition for the region's stunning views and background.
